Hajime: A Culinary Masterpiece in Osaka
The restaurant Hajime in Osaka, Japan, is not just a place to eat, but an extraordinary experience. With its art reflected in every dish and a focus on innovative, plant-based moments of enjoyment, Hajime attracts food connoisseurs from around the world. Located in Nishi Ward at the address Edobori, 1-chōme-9-11, Osaka, it is one of the few dining establishments to have earned the prestigious title of three Michelin stars – and in record time.
Historical Background
Hajime was founded in May 2008 by Chef Hajime Yoneda. He has a remarkable career, having left his well-paid job as an engineer to pursue his passion for gastronomy. Just 17 months after opening, the restaurant achieved its first three Michelin stars, marking a notable rise that remains unmatched to this day. Following a reorientation towards creative cuisine in 2012, the restaurant again received the accolade of three Michelin stars in 2017.
The Culinary Experience
At Hajime, you can expect an impressive tasting menu offered in various price variations: the minimalist version for ¥60,500, the vegan menu for ¥67,100, and the standard menu for ¥71,500 per person (plus 15% service charge). Chef Hajime Yoneda places great emphasis on presentation and uses high-quality, seasonal ingredients. Each dish is served with an artistic touch that takes the visitor on a flavor journey through the tastes of Japan.
The atmosphere in the restaurant is both moody and romantic, ideal for special occasions. The service is praised as exceptional – the staff is highly motivated and committed to ensuring that every guest has an unforgettable experience.
Special Dishes and Wines
A highlight of the menu is the dish "Planet Earth," which consists of a variety of ingredients and seduces the palate with complex flavors. The wine pairing is often rated as excellent, though some guests express a desire for the sommelier to take more time for explanations.
Costs
The prices at Hajime reflect the exclusivity and quality of the food offered. Aside from the aforementioned menu options, guests should expect additional costs for wine pairings and possible tips, so a budget between ¥100,000 and ¥150,000 per person should be planned for a complete experience.
